Canadian health care system is simpler to understand than the US model in many ways, as well as other systems around the world. While it is largely paid for publicly, it is delivered privately, and Canadians are empowered to choose any health care provider they like, and the government will reimburse that practitioner with an agreed-upon fee for service.
No, Canada’s health care system is not perfect. There are problems, ranging from long wait times to the gender gap. However, when compared with most other nations, Canada’s system ranks very well. How does Canadian health care work? It’s a single-payer system, with most funds coming from the federal government. However, charitable contributions and even private insurance have roles to play, as well.
